eHarmony to Provide Gay Dating Service After Lawsuit
Online dating service eHarmony has agreed to create a new Web site - 'Compatible Partners' - for gays and lesbians, the New Jersey Office of the Attorney General announced.

Sued, eHarmony Must Couple GaysPoliGazette
In 2005, eHarmony, a leading on-line matchmaking service, began to fight a discrimination lawsuit filed by a gay man in New Jersey.  In 2007, the state’s attorney general found probable cause that eHarmony had violated N.J.’s Law Against Discrimination.  Today the ...
